Density Altitude at Muscatine Municipal (KMUT)

Muscatine Municipal sits at 547 ft, and even a typical July afternoon (85 °F) only lifts density altitude to about 2,372 ft — heat still trims performance, but the field rarely turns high-and-hot.

Typical density altitude by month

From NOAA 1991–2020 monthly normals at MUSCATINE (5 mi from the field) · standard pressure, dry air
Month Avg temp °F DA at avg temp Afternoon high °F DA on a typical afternoon
January 22.1 −1,838 ft 31.0 −1,206 ft
February 26.7 −1,509 ft 35.9 −864 ft
March 39.0 −650 ft 49.5 64 ft
April 51.2 177 ft 63.1 961 ft
May 62.3 909 ft 73.6 1,634 ft
June 71.6 1,507 ft 82.3 2,180 ft
July 74.8 1,710 ft 85.4 2,372 ft
August 72.6 1,571 ft 83.3 2,242 ft
September 65.7 1,129 ft 77.6 1,886 ft
October 53.2 311 ft 64.5 1,052 ft
November 39.3 −629 ft 49.0 30 ft
December 27.8 −1,431 ft 36.1 −850 ft

▲ above 5,000 ft · ⚠ above 8,000 ft. These are planning references at standard pressure and dry air — afternoon humidity and low pressure both push the real number higher. Run today's values below.

Frequently asked questions

How high does density altitude get at KMUT in summer?

On a typical July afternoon — around 85 °F at the nearest NOAA normals station — density altitude at Muscatine Municipal reaches roughly 2,372 ft at standard pressure. Hotter-than-normal days, low pressure, and humidity all push it higher, so run the day's actual numbers before flying.

What is the density altitude at KMUT on an average day?

It swings with the seasons: from roughly −1,838 ft at the coldest month's average temperature to about 1,710 ft at the warmest month's — all from a constant field elevation of 547 ft. The month-by-month table above carries the full year.

What is the field elevation of Muscatine Municipal?

547 ft MSL, from the FAA NASR airport record (28-day cycle effective 2026-08-06). The identifier is KMUT (ICAO) / MUT (FAA), in Muscatine, Iowa.
